Abstract

A system and method of determining a composite automated site engagement (CASE) index for a website are provided, including tracking user activities at the website, and if a weighted value associated with a user activity has changed based on the tracking, calculating a market value for the user activity, calculating a divisor value for a new CASE index, calculating the new CASE index based upon the market value and the divisor, and updating a database to reflect the new CASE index.

Claims (98)

1 . A computer-implemented method of determining a composite automated site engagement (CASE) index for a website, comprising:

tracking user activities at the website;

if a weighted value associated with a user activity has changed based on the tracking,

calculating a market value for the user activity,

calculating a divisor value for a new CASE index,

calculating the new CASE index based upon the market value and the divisor, and

updating a database to reflect the new CASE index.

2 . A computer-implemented method in accordance with claim 1 , wherein said CASE index is a market capitalized base weighted index.

3 . A computer-implemented method in accordance with claim 1 , wherein user activities include one or more of clicking through an advertisement, adding a new friend of a social network, expanding a social network, posting real user activities, uploading multimedia, sharing multimedia, clicking, accessing, or sharing content already uploaded to the website, clicking a shared web-link, URL, or other dynamic content previously posted, new user registration, increasing/decreasing number of friends, web sales, photo deletion, and content removal.

4 . A computer-implemented method in accordance with claim 1 , wherein the weight of said weighted value is configured to change over time or in response with regard to user activity.

5 . A computer-implemented method in accordance with claim 4 , wherein said weight is computed on the fly.

6 . A computer-implemented method in accordance with claim 1 , wherein the market value is dependent on the type of activity and the weight of the engagement.

7 . A computer-implemented method in accordance with claim 1 , wherein the divisor is dependent upon a previous divisor and a previous CASE index value.

8 . A computer-implemented method in accordance with claim 7 , wherein said divisor is determined by

A computer-implemented method in accordance with claim 1 , further comprising determining a type of user activity according to user interaction with a website, wherein said type of user activity is determined through processing of available engagement types, weights and values associated with a particular form of interaction.

11 . A computer-implemented method in accordance with claim 10 , further comprising determining an engagement portfolio value (EPV) for a user based upon the type of engagement detected, wherein said EPV is a value representing a sum of all of the user's engagements taking into consideration associated weights.

12 . A computer-implemented method in accordance with claim 11 , wherein said EPV is calculated according to EPV=Σ i=1 n E i *W i .

13 . A computer-implemented method in accordance with claim 11 , further comprising updating said CASE index based upon a user's EPV.

14 . A computer-implemented method in accordance with claim 13 , further comprising associating a particular user's EPV with a website, such that further interaction of said particular user with the website will increase the particular user's EPV.

15 . A system for determining a composite automated site engagement (CASE) index for a website, comprising:

a publication portion configured to publish the CASE index;

an administration portion in communication with the publication portion; and

a subscription portion in communication with the administration portion;

wherein the administrative portion is configured to perform a method, the method comprising:

tracking user activities at the website;

if a weighted value associated with a user activity has changed based on the tracking,

calculating a market value for the user activity,

calculating a divisor value for a new CASE index,

calculating the new CASE index based upon the market value and the divisor,

updating a database to reflect the new CASE index, and

transmitting the new CASE index to the subscription portion.

16 . A system in accordance with claim 15 , wherein said publication portion includes a publishing application programming interface (API) in communication with engagement endpoints related to the CASE index of a particular website.

17 . A system in accordance with claim 16 , further comprising a complex event processing engine in communication with said API and an engagements database.

18 . A system in accordance with claim 15 , wherein said administration portion includes an administration API configured to allow administrative control of calculations related to a CASE index for a website.

19 . A system in accordance with claim 15 , wherein said subscription portion includes a subscription API configured to facilitate relay of information from subscribers to a CASE index cache cluster.
